Sierra Nevada Job Corps’ Got Talent!

Sierra Nevada Job Corps students and staff recently gathered to cheer on participants in the first annual Sierra Nevada Job Corps’ Got Talent competition.  The event featured the singing, rapping, and dancing talents of 11 students.  Each of the performing acts made it through to the competition after first facing a round of try outs for the event.  Judges for the competition included Bob the Biker from KTVN Channel 2, a former Miss Nevada competitor, and two staff members with a plethora of musical, performance and on-camera experience. 

The competitors showcased a multitude of talents, including beat-boxing, a vocal and guitar duet and a rap and dance combination.  In the end, an inspiring and original interpretive dance by student Josh Peoples won.  The student performers were all proud to be able to demonstrate their artistic abilities for their friends, mentors and teachers and prove that Sierra Nevada Job Corps’ Got Talent!
